Output 58dd99845084b4ed36da8138c25bd2696c05be496e99d5d568dcf5ba9e2baf7e:5

value
53357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f6887de49631a8c1ffaa5d85eb20863a63e194 OP_EQUAL
address
3BAirj8ueAieMbeq5fFNZZDcc5MSd74FfD
transaction
58dd99845084b4ed36da8138c25bd2696c05be496e99d5d568dcf5ba9e2baf7e
spent
true